Beschrijving
Clementine is heartbroken when she hears the news that her favorite teacher, Mr. D'Matz, may be transferring to another school. This sudden change disrupts her world, and the thought of losing him ignites a whirlwind of emotions. As she grapples with her feelings, Clementine decides that she must take action to express her affection and appreciation for Mr. D'Matz.
Determined to make a difference, Clementine embarks on a mission to write a heartfelt letter filled with the memories and valuable lessons learned in his classroom. Through her words, she hopes to convey just how much he means to her and her classmates. The process becomes a reflection of her own growth and understanding of friendship, love, and the difficulty of transitions.
As she navigates this challenge, readers witness Clementine’s resilience and creativity shine through. Her adventure teaches valuable lessons about communication and the importance of acknowledging those who impact our lives, while also capturing the vivid emotions of childhood. This story beautifully illustrates the power of connection and the lasting impression a teacher can have on their students.
